Unsaturated solution: A solution with less solute that completely dissolves without leaving any remaining substance
Saturated solution: A solution with solute that dissolves until it can't dissolve anymore, leaving some of the remaining substance left.
Supersaturated solution: A solution that has more remaining substance left than a saturated solution and tends to crystallize more than a saturated solution.
